RGB Recruitment Ltd is seeking a Junior MEP Revit Technician/Engineer to join a growing consultancy in Plymouth focused on sustainability. This role offers extensive training and development within MEP design, BIM, and Revit. Ideal for college leavers or recent graduates eager to start their careers in building services.

In this development-focused position, you will work alongside experienced engineers, supporting MEP model production, gaining hands-on exposure to projects, and learning how to create sustainable engineering solutions.
